SAP CMS_RE_STR_BLD_SUMMARY Structure for Building summary details Table data and field list

CMS_RE_STR_BLD_SUMMARY is a standard SAP Structure so does not store data like a database table does. It can be used to define the fields of other actual tables or to process "Structure for Building summary details" Information within sap ABAP programs.

This is done by declaring abap internal tables, work areas or database tables based on this Structure. These can then be used to store and process the required data appropriately.

i.e. DATA: wa_CMS_RE_STR_BLD_SUMMARY TYPE CMS_RE_STR_BLD_SUMMARY.

Field Description Data Element Data Type length (Dec) Check table Conversion Routine Domain Name MemoryID SHLP
NO_UNITSNo of units in real estate object CMS_RE_DTE_NO_UNITINT410CMS_RE_UNITS
NO_FLOORSNumber of Floors CMS_RE_DTE_NO_FLOORINT410CMS_RE_UNITS
NO_CUR_UNITSNo of current units in real estate object CMS_RE_DTE_NO_CUR_UNITINT410CMS_RE_UNITS
NO_CUR_UNITS_RENNo of Current Units Rented in Real Estate Object CMS_RE_DTE_NO_CUR_UNIT_RENINT410CMS_RE_UNITS
NO_OLD_UNITSNo of old units in real estate object CMS_RE_DTE_NO_OLD_UNITINT410CMS_RE_UNITS
NO_OLD_UNITS_RENNo of Old Units Rented in Real Estate Object CMS_RE_DTE_NO_OLD_UNIT_RENINT410CMS_RE_UNITS
NO_NEW_UNITSNo of new units in real estate object CMS_RE_DTE_NO_NEW_UNITINT410CMS_RE_UNITS
NO_NEW_UNITS_RENNo of New units Rented in Real Estate Object CMS_RE_DTE_NO_NEW_UNIT_RENINT410CMS_RE_UNITS
NO_GARAGESNo of Garages in Real Estate Object CMS_RE_DTE_NO_GARINT410CMS_RE_UNITS
NO_GARAGES_RENNo of Garages Rented in Real Estate Object CMS_RE_DTE_NO_GAR_RENINT410CMS_RE_UNITS
NO_PARK_UNITNumber of Parking Units CMS_RE_DTE_NO_PARK_UNITINT410CMS_RE_UNITS
NO_PARK_UNIT_RENNumber of Parking Units Rented CMS_RE_DTE_NO_PARK_UNIT_RENINT410CMS_RE_UNITS
NO_PARK_UGNumber of Underground Parking Units CMS_RE_DTE_NO_PARK_UNIT_UGINT410CMS_RE_UNITS
NO_PARK_UG_RENNumber of Rented Underground Parking Units CMS_RE_DTE_NO_PARK_UNIT_UG_RENINT410CMS_RE_UNITS

How do I retrieve data from SAP structure CMS_RE_STR_BLD_SUMMARY using ABAP code?

As CMS_RE_STR_BLD_SUMMARY is a database structure and not a table it does not store any data in the SAP data dictionary. The ABAP SELECT statement is therefore not appropriate and can not be performed on CMS_RE_STR_BLD_SUMMARY as there is no data to select.
